Stir-fried tofu in tomato sauce (Dau Sot Ca Chua) This simple dish consists of fried tofu and softened tomatoes, seasoned with fish sauce and quickly simmered. It is topped with sliced scallions and served with fluffy rice. Indulge in the tangy flavors of Dau Sot Ca Chua, a dish that evokes childhood memories in most Vietnamese homes. The deep-fried tofu, marinated in a silky homemade tomato sauce, is both comforting and flavorful. It pairs perfectly with steamed rice, allowing the flavors to blend harmoniously...
